Over 70 vehicles were involved in multiple crashes, resulting in eight&nbsp;fatalities and over 30 people injured. Gary Spaulding and Salvation Army Chaplain Don Durbin weaved in and out of the wreckage to help first responders and victims of this large-scale&nbsp;accident.&nbsp;&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Gary has been dedicated to the disaster service ministry in Springfield, Illinois, for over four&nbsp;years. He is an excellent example of servant leadership. While Gary was honored to receive the award, he was also quick to give credit&nbsp;to the teamwork that took place. In&nbsp;particular, he mentioned Karol Young, who helped coordinate the serving of food for over 135 people that were either crash victims or first responders who were called to the scene.&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Gary and Salvation Army Major Jeff Eddy have built a strong disaster service team for Sangamon County and served in multiple events.
